Special masks created for reading lips

 

800_87339056d4ba00f.jpg

 

The Social Development and Human Security Ministry introduced face masks especially created for people with impaired hearing on Tuesday (April 21).

 

Patcharee Arayakul, the ministry’s deputy permanent secretary, presented the masks at a press conference, explaining that the mouth area was covered in the transparent film so the hearing impaired can read lips when communicating.

 

She added that face masks are necessary for protection during this crisis and the ministry wanted to create one especially for people who rely on lip-reading.
